Criteria for Registered Agents and Expenses

In the process of forming an LLC or corporation, selecting a registered agent is one of the key requirements for compliance. Every state has distinct registered agent requirements, which typically include that the agent must be a resident of the state where the business is formed or a corporation licensed to perform business there. Additionally, the registered agent must be on-call during regular business hours to receive legal documents and official government correspondence. It is crucial for businesses to grasp the local regulations to ensure their registered agent meets every statutory obligations.

The costs associated with engaging a registered agent can fluctuate greatly based on the provider and the services offered. Basic registered agent services often fall from 50 to 300 dollars per year, depending on considerations such as location and extra features included. Many registered agent companies provide package deals that may include compliance reminders, document handling, and virtual office services, which can enhance the value of their service offerings. Looking into and comparing registered agent service fees and offerings can aid businesses find an cost-effective registered agent solution that meets their specific needs.

Allocating funds for a trustworthy registered agent is crucial for maintaining good standing with state regulations and shielding business interests. Failure to comply with registered agent requirements can result in repercussions, including fines or the inability to carry on business legally in the state. Hence, it is advisable for business owners to take into account the first-time costs but also the long-term value and reliability provided by their preferred registered agent provider.

Frequent Misconceptions Regarding Designated Representatives

Countless enterprise owners think that a registered agent is just a formality, believing they can navigate their own legal documents without any assistance. Nevertheless, the role of a registered agent is vital in ensuring that important legal notifications are delivered in a efficient manner. Failing to have a reliable registered agent can result to missed deadlines, fines, and consequently loss of good standing with the state. This is particularly true for LLCs and corporations, which have particular registered agent obligations that must be met to maintain compliance.

One more misconception is that registered agents are only necessary for larger businesses or corporations. In reality, all LLC and corporation, regardless of size, is obliged to have a registered agent. This covers small businesses, startups, and also nonprofit organizations. A credentialed registered agent provides important services such as compliance tracking and annual report filing, ensuring that all statutory obligations are completed, thus aiding businesses of all sizes.

Certain entrepreneurs consider that hiring a registered agent means they are relinquishing control over their business communications. In fact, a registered agent acts as an intermediary, processing legal documents and notifications while the entrepreneur owner can focus on running their operations. By using a business registered agent, business owners gain not only confidence but also the guarantee that their legal responsibilities are managed effectively and securely.
